What You'll Do

  • Build responsive, mobile-first websites using React, HTML, CSS, and modern JavaScript
  • Work with headless CMS setups (typically WordPress with ACF) and integrate front ends with dynamic content
  • Pull data from REST or GraphQL APIs and structure it for clean, fast user experiences
  • Translate Figma designs into clean, accessible code that works across devices and browsers
  • Maintain and improve existing WordPress and static websites
  • Collaborate with other developers, designers, and content creators to build cohesive platforms
  • Support internal innovation projects, including AI-enhanced tools and in-house app development

What We’re Looking For

Technical Skills

  • Proficiency in React, JavaScript (ES6+), and HTML/CSS
  • Experience working with WordPress, including Advanced Custom Fields and custom post types
  • Familiarity with headless CMS setups and static site generators like Gatsby or Astro
  • Experience using AI coding tools like Cursor and Claude Code
  • Ability to fetch and integrate data from REST and GraphQL APIs
  • Understanding of technical SEO principles and how development impacts site performance and visibility
  • Ability to translate Figma designs into responsive, cross-browser-compatible websites
